Lori Newman is a EuroDance Champion
The motion
That the Parliament congratulates 12-year-old Lori Newman on being crowned 2023 EuroDance under-14 champion, after impressing judges with her slow dance routine; understands that Lori, from Greenock, is a rising star and hopes to follow in the footsteps of her teacher, Lauren Hair, who starred in the TV show Got to Dance, and was recently named the Greenock Telegraph Community Champion Teacher of the Year; notes that Lori, who took her first dance steps aged seven, had to dance in five heats, and was up against other fantastic dancers at the competition in Southport; believes that her commitment to training every single day in the studio, and at home, helped her beat her rivals, and wishes Lori all the best as she continues to hone her skills and compete in dance competitions as she pursues her dream.
